Heads up: the Crumbline Orders API enforces a hard cutoff for next-day bakery orders at 6 PM shop-local time. Any POST to /orders after cutoff gets bumped to the following delivery window automatically — no error, just a shifted date in the response, so check the `fulfillment_date` field. This trips up everyone at least once. To try it yourself against the staging bakery at Millet & Fog, authenticate with the internal key below.

service key, yadug-bajog: zpat3_pou

**Checklist item 7 — Run the string extraction script**

Before tagging a Lindqvist Suite release, run the `extract-strings` script from the repo root and commit the regenerated catalogue files. If the script reports orphaned keys, flag them to the localisation channel rather than deleting them yourself — translators may still be mid-flight. Once the catalogue is clean, paste the extraction run's trace token here.

trace token, kajeg-bajop: htk6_46382d

# Heads up, support folks! This env file tunes notification fan-out for Pingleaf.
# When the fan-out queue backs up (usually during big campaign blasts), the
# backpressure limiter kicks in and throttles outbound pushes. If customers
# complain about delayed alerts, check FANOUT_MAX_INFLIGHT first — bumping it
# past 500 without asking the Relay team is a bad idea, trust us.
# The limiter won't start at all unless it can authenticate against the
# Pingleaf queue broker. The broker credential goes on the next line.

sealed setting: LEDGER_TOKEN13=5d842615a26d7

## Restarting the Gaugepost Sidecar

If metrics stop flowing from a pod, restart the Gaugepost aggregation sidecar before escalating. Confirm `AGG_FLUSH_INTERVAL=30` and `AGG_BUFFER_MAX=5000` in the sidecar's env file, as wrong values cause dropped samples. The sidecar authenticates to the Tallyrook collector with a shared secret, which must appear on the next line.

vault entry, hahaf-tafog: VAULT_KEY3=38a

FAQ: Why are Parchmint templates slow on first render?

First render compiles each template to bytecode and caches it; subsequent renders should be under 5 ms. If every request is slow, the cache volume is likely missing. Contractors can warm the cache via the prewarm task. To unlock the staging cache store, use the passphrase below.

unlock words, bafop-fawig: fraax-novys-ulair